Kris Fichigami on the Ukulele

February 4, 2019 @ 6:00 pm - 7:00 pm

Kris Fuchigami headshot

Born and raised on the Big Island, 13 year old Kris Fuchigami began his musical journey Two years later Kris won the grand prize at the Hamakua Music Scholarship Competition on the Big Island where he competed against classical pianists, singers, drummers, and many other musicians.

Kris went on to perform at and headline ukulele festivals and has gained recognition throughout the world.  Kris has released 4 CDs and has been privileged to perform with music greats such as Jake Shimabukuro, Mark Yamanaka, Yoza, Daniel Ho, Brittni Paiva, and many more!
Kris’ YouTube videos have accumulated, in total, over one million views by fans all over the world.

He is recognized as one of the top ukulele artists in the world.
